
A fatal road accident in Dhanbad has resulted in the untimely deaths of two young men, leaving their families and the community in shock. The accident happened on the Rajganj Six Lane. Among the victims were Sahil Krishnani, the 24-year-old son of the owner of Dhanbad’s Raymond showroom, and Anmol, the 25-year-old son of the owner of a motor parts shop in Matkuria Chamber. The vehicle, an I-20 car, was traveling towards Rajganj from Barwa Adda when the driver lost control. The car overturned and collided with the divider before landing on its side on the approach road.
Upon receiving the information, local police arrived, starting rescue operations that were difficult to conduct due to a heavy downpour. A crane from NHAI was used to lift the vehicle and recover the bodies. The bodies were then transported to Dhanbad SNMCH. The cause of the accident is under investigation, and officials are trying to determine how the car lost control. There is speculation about the involvement of other vehicles or whether other factors played a part in the incident. The victims were reportedly on their way to a restaurant located in Topchanchi, but families have not released any comments.
